TNW, Andersons expand rail-car services in Texas


The expansion in services will include rail-car cleaning and flaring, a full-service repair shop for tank cars and hoppers, rail-car storage and Class I interchanges.

TNW Corp. recently expanded rail-car service offerings on its Texas North Western Railway (TXNW) line in Sunray, Texas, in partnership with The Andersons Rail Group.

TNW owns the largest private storage facility in North America at the TXNW Railway, company officials said in a press release. The expansion in services will include rail-car cleaning and flaring, a full-service repair shop for tank cars and hoppers, rail-car storage and Class I interchanges.

The repair shop will provide general Association of American Railroads and Federal Railroad Administration repairs, as well as HM-216 tank-car qualification. The shop also will perform M-1002 certifications.

"TNW and The Andersons understand the importance for shippers and leasing companies who are looking to combine rail-car cleaning, repairs and storage in one location to effectively manage their fleet," said Wade Hoffman, TNW's vice president of marketing and sales.

Sam Anderson, VP of The Andersons Rail Group, added: "Investments into the repair infrastructure on TXNW allow us to provide a full suite of tank car repair services, including tank car certifications. The shop is adjacent to the TXNW storage yard, and we believe the geographical location, Class I connection, and strong partnership with TNW will add significant value to our customers."
